TF206 is a highly resilient non asbestos fiber friction material with a structure designed to provide good energy capability, stable friction characteristics, low wear and long service life. TF206 offers a low static to dynamic coefficient of friction for enhanced engagement characteristics, excellent energy capability, and good wear resistance.

Friction Properties

  • Static Friction Coefficient : 0.13-0.16 ±0.05μ
  • Dynamic Friction Coefficient: 0.11-0.14 ±0.05 μ

Physical Properties

  • Dynamic Pressure: 3.5 N/mm² (508 Lbf/in²)
  • Rubbing Speed: 35 m/s (115 Ft/sec)
  • Specific Power: 4.0 W/mm² (3.4 HP/in²)
  • Multi-pass tangential oil groove patterns in a variety of configurations. Grooves can either be pressed or machined.
  • Thickness: Max 1.50mm (0.06”) to Min 0.40mm (0.02").
  • Diameter: Max 1,000 mm (36.37").

Applications

Transmission Clutches
Power Shift and Power Take Off Transmissions.
Wheel Brakes.

Recommended Mating Surfaces: Cast Iron with surface finish < 0.5µm Ra (20µin CLA).
Steel hardened & tempered, Cast Steel, Cast Gray Iron.:
The above data is taken from specific test parameters, therefore results can vary in differing application conditions:
